World Sanskrit Day: Revival
- In which Schedule of the Indian Constitution is Sanskrit listed as a major modern language? – Eighth Schedule
- According to National Education Policy (NEP) 2020, which subjects are included under ‘Sanskrit Knowledge Systems’? – Philosophy, Logic, Grammar, Mathematics, Medicine, Music, Poetry, Architecture, Linguistics
- Which great centers of learning are mentioned in the ancient Indian education system? – Nalanda, Takshashila and Vikramshila
- According to NEP 2020, which is considered the supreme human goal of education? –Gyaan (Knowledge),Pragya (Wisdom) and Satya(Truth/Reality)
- Under NEP 2020, which language has also been made a mainstream option under the Three-Language Formula? – Sanskrit
